Mercedes Mone Says AEW Has The Best Wrestlers; Feels Her Double or Nothing Match Stole The Show

-- Mercedes Mone made her AEW in-ring debut last weekend at Double or Nothing and put on a very good match against Willow Nightingale, drawing praise after a lengthy absence. Speaking to TMZ Sports, Mone took it a step further, suggesting that her match against Nightingale "stole the show" and "tore it out of the park."

"I mean- Willow’s the one that I suffered my injury with one year ago. Took me out for a whole year - the doctor said, they’re not sure if I was gonna be back in wrestling but I told them, no, this is my life, this is my dream. Nobody can tell me, no, I can’t do it."

"So I fought so hard to get back and Willow had something that I wanted and I told her that money changes everything. This past Sunday at Double or Nothing, we went out there and we stole the show. We tore it out of the park and she is legit one of the best that I’ve ever been in the ring with. I definitely can’t wait to tie it in the ring with her again."
